You're talking to the same family who runs the listings on every platform — we just don't pay a 14–20% service fee to a middleman when you book here. That savings comes off your total. Same hosts, same cabanas, same support — better price.
You also get direct access to us before, during, and after your stay (no platform messaging in the middle), and we can be more flexible on small things like dock space, late check-out, or stitching together gap nights.
Bookings are processed through Stripe, the same payment processor used by major brands worldwide. We accept all major credit cards. We never see or store your card details — Stripe handles everything end to end.
High season (Dec 21 – May 31): $299/night base rate.
Low season (Jun 1 – Dec 20): $159/night base rate.
Event weeks (around major holidays and fishing tournaments): $399/night.
Minimum stay: 2 nights on weekdays, 3 nights on weekends. We sometimes allow 1-night gap-night bookings if there's a single night open between other reservations — the live calculator on each cabana page will show you in real time.
Cleaning fee, taxes, and any extra-guest fees are added on top — you'll see the full breakdown before you confirm.
Standard occupancy is 2 guests. Cabanas 1, 2, 3, 5, and 6 sleep up to 4; Cabana 4 sleeps up to 3.
Guests beyond 2 are charged a small extra-guest fee per night, applied to the booking total. The exact amount appears in the live quote breakdown on each cabana page once you enter your guest count.
Yes — every cabana page has a live quote calculator. Enter your dates and party size and you'll see the full breakdown (nightly rate × nights, cleaning, taxes, any extra-guest fees, total) instantly. No commitment, no email required.

Check-in: 4:00 PM
Check-out: 11:00 AM
We offer self check-in with a keypad code emailed to you the morning of arrival. If you'd like a personal greeting at the property, just let us know your ETA in advance.
Early check-in and late check-out are sometimes available depending on the schedule — message us a day or two ahead and we'll try to make it work at no extra charge.
Each cabana comes fully equipped — you only need to bring clothes, a swimsuit, and a sense of humor.
Full per-cabana amenities lists are on each cabana page.
Yes — one parking space per cabana, free of charge. If you have more than one car, talk to us in advance and we'll see what we can do (usually fine, depending on who else is staying).
Unfortunately, no pets — sorry to the dog parents. We've found that pet allergens linger in small studios and impact other guests, so we keep all six cabanas pet-free.
Need a recommendation for a great kennel or sitter in Key Largo? Email us and we'll send a list.
No smoking inside the cabanas (including vaping). Outside on the patio is fine, but please use the provided ashtray and dispose of butts properly — we love this canal and so do the fish.
Yes — we host families regularly. The property has open canal-edge access, so guests with young kids should keep an eye on them around the water. We don't have pack-n-plays or high chairs on site, but they're easy to rent from local services if you need them.
Yes — a washer and dryer are available on the property for guest use. Free detergent provided.

We have one dock space at the property available for guest rental, on a first-come, first-served basis.
Dock rates:
Because there's only one space across six cabanas, we strongly recommend reserving it when you book. Mention "dock space needed" in the inquiry form or email reservations@waterfrontcabanas.com — we'll confirm availability for your dates.
No — there is no boat ramp on-site. You'll need to launch your boat at a public ramp and motor over to our dock.

The slip comfortably fits boats up to about 24 feet. Tighter for anything bigger, but message us with your boat's specs and we'll let you know if it'll work.
Absolutely. Across US-1 you'll find Paddle The Florida Keys for kayak and SUP rentals (deliverable straight to our canal). For powered options, charters and boat rentals are easy to book in Key Largo — see the Guide Book for our favorite operators.

300 Buttonwood Circle, Key Largo, FL 33037. Just off US-1 at Mile Marker 99, on a private saltwater canal that opens to the Atlantic.
From Miami International Airport: about 1 hour 15 minutes south on US-1. From Fort Lauderdale: about 2 hours. We're the first major stop in the Florida Keys.
Yes — strongly recommended. Key Largo is spread out along US-1 and there's no public transit. Most restaurants, dive shops, and attractions are a short drive away. Rideshare (Uber/Lyft) works but coverage thins out at night.

John Pennekamp Coral Reef State Park is 10 minutes north on US-1 — America's first underwater park and the gateway to the Florida Keys reef. Glass-bottom boats, snorkel tours to the Christ of the Abyss statue, scuba charters, kayak launches, and a swim beach.

Full refund for cancellations made 30+ days before check-in.
50% refund for cancellations made 14–29 days before check-in.
No refund for cancellations made within 14 days of check-in.
We're flexible when something unavoidable comes up — illness, family emergency, weather closures. Email us as soon as you know and we'll work with you, often by rebooking your stay for a future date.
If a mandatory evacuation is issued for Monroe County that covers your stay dates, you'll receive a full refund or free rebooking — no questions asked.
Outside of mandatory evacuations, our regular cancellation policy applies. We recommend travel insurance during hurricane season (June – November) as an extra layer of protection.
No upfront damage deposit, but you're responsible for any damage beyond normal wear and tear. We've hosted hundreds of guests with zero incidents — we trust people to treat the cabanas the way they'd want their own home treated.
10 PM to 8 AM. Six cabanas share thin Keys walls and a small property, so we ask everyone to keep evening volume reasonable. Patio conversations, music low, no parties.
The cabanas are designed for guests staying overnight, not for events. Small family gatherings on your own patio are fine. Larger events, parties, or non-registered visitors aren't permitted out of respect for other guests.
